linux查看网络情况命令是

不及物动词 其他 96

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ux查看网络情况常用命令有以下几个:

    1. ifconfig:查看网络接口的IP地址、子网掩码、MAC地址等信息。例如:ifconfig eth0。

    2. ip:与ifconfig类似,用于显示和配置网络接口以及路由表、ARP缓存等。例如:ip addr show。

    3. netstat:显示网络连接、路由表、接口统计信息等。常用选项包括“-a”显示所有连接,“-t”显示TCP连接,“-u”显示UDP连接。例如:netstat -tuan。

    4. ss:与netstat类似,用于查看网络连接和统计信息。优点是速度更快且占用更少的资源。例如:ss -tun.

    5. ping:用于检测网络连通性。例如:ping http://www.google.com。

    6. traceroute:用于跟踪数据包在网络中的路径。例如:traceroute http://www.google.com。

    7. nslookup/dig:用于进行DNS查询。例如:nslookup http://www.google.com。

    8. route:用于查看和配置静态路由表。例如:route -n。

    9. iftop:用于实时监测网络流量。例如:iftop -i eth0。

    以上是Linux中常用的查看网络情况的命令,可以根据需要选择合适的命令来查看网络信息。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ux中查看网络情况的命令有很多,下面是几个常用的命令:

    1. ifconfig :这个命令用于显示当前网络接口的配置信息,包括IP地址、子网掩码、网关等。

    2. netstat :这个命令用于显示网络连接信息,包括当前打开的连接、监听的端口等。

    3. ping :这个命令用于测试网络连接的可达性和延迟。通过向目标主机发送ICMP回显请求并等待回应,可以判断是否能够与目标主机正常通信。

    4. traceroute :这个命令用于追踪网络数据包的路径。通过向目标主机发送一系列的UDP数据包并观察其经过的路由器,可以确定数据包在网络中所经过路由节点的路径。

    5. nslookup :这个命令用于查询域名的解析信息。通过向DNS服务器发送查询请求,可以获得一个域名对应的IP地址。

    6. tcpdump :这个命令用于捕获网络数据包的工具。它可以显示网络上的数据包,并可以根据指定的过滤条件进行过滤和分析。

    除了这些常用的命令外,还有一些其他的命令也可以在Linux中查看网络情况,例如:ifup/ifdown(用于启动/停止网络接口)、route(用于显示和操作IP路由表)、iwconfig(用于配置和显示无线网络接口)、ss(用于显示套接字统计信息)等。

    通过使用这些命令,我们可以方便地查看Linux系统的网络情况,诊断网络问题,并进行一些网络配置和管理操作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,我们可以使用一些命令来查看网络情况。下面是一些常用的命令:

    1. ifconfig:
    ifconfig命令用于查看和配置网络接口信息。可以使用ifconfig命令来查看网络接口的IP地址、子网掩码、MAC地址等。例如,运行ifconfig命令可以查看所有网络接口的详细信息。

    2. ip addr:
    ip addr命令也用于查看和配置网络接口信息。与ifconfig命令不同的是,ip addr命令提供了更多的功能和选项。例如,运行ip addr命令可以查看所有网络接口的详细信息,包括IP地址、子网掩码、MAC地址等。

    3. netstat:
    netstat命令用于查看网络连接、路由表和网络统计信息等。可以使用netstat命令来查看当前活动的网络连接、开放的端口、路由表等。例如,运行netstat -an命令可以查看所有的网络连接信息。

    4. ss:
    ss命令是netstat命令的一个替代品,能够更快速地显示网络统计信息和网络连接等。与netstat命令相比,ss命令的输出更加简洁和清晰。例如,运行ss -t命令可以查看所有TCP连接的状态。

    5. ping:
    ping命令用于测试网络连接的连通性。可以使用ping命令来发送网络报文到指定的目标地址,以检测网络是否可达。例如,运行ping http://www.google.com命令可以测试与Google的网络连接。

    6. traceroute:
    traceroute命令用于跟踪网络数据包在路由器上的路径。可以使用traceroute命令来查看数据包从本机到目标主机的传输路径。例如,运行traceroute http://www.google.com命令可以查看到Google服务器所经过的路由器。

    7. iftop:
    iftop命令用于实时监测网络流量。可以使用iftop命令来实时查看网络流量的情况,包括每个网络接口的入站流量和出站流量。例如,运行iftop命令可以查看当前网络接口的流量情况。

    8. tcpdump:
    tcpdump命令用于抓取网络数据包。可以使用tcpdump命令来捕获网络上的数据包,并可以根据一定的过滤规则进行过滤。例如,运行tcpdump -i eth0命令可以抓取eth0接口上的数据包。

    以上是一些常用的命令,可以帮助你查看和了解Linux系统的网络情况。根据不同的需求,选择合适的命令可以更好地进行网络故障排查和性能优化等工作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部